Here S Where The Cows Are Dairy Herd Below is a table indicating cow numbers for the top 24 states as of july 2019. for the first time in 2017, the census captured data on states that are home to the largest dairies. since the most cows are in the west, it stands to reason the biggest dairies are there, too. california and idaho are tied with the most dairies with more than 5,000. Herd Of Dairy Cows Discover Dairy Percent of u.s. dairy herd residing on farms with more than 1,000 cows. 1997 – 17%; 2007 – 40%; 2017 – 55%; 2022 – 65% “in the future, it is likely that more cows will move to larger farms, which are able to produce milk at a lower cost versus smaller operations. growth in the number of larger herds will persist, but smaller farms will continue to exist in sizable numbers, especi. Through 2022, the average number of milk cows in the nation’s dairy herd shrank by 0.5% to 9.4 million head, or 100,000 fewer cows than in 2021, according to bussler. the average dairy herd size reached a record high of 337 head in 2022. that number has grown steadily in the past 20 years, from 129 cows in 2003. Of the 9 million dairy cows in the u.s., approximately 90% of them are of the holstein descent. [68] the top breed of dairy cow within canada's national herd category is holstein, taking up 93% of the dairy cow population, have a production rate of 10,257 kilograms (22,613 lb) of milk per cow that contains 3.9% butter fat and 3.2% protein [8]. The percentage of herds with crossbred cows increased across all thresholds. the je breed also displayed positive growth up to a 75% threshold. in particular, the percentage of herds keeping at least one je increased 15.7% percentage points. at a 10% threshold, this figure increased 4.6 percentage points over 29 years.
